Orbeon如何处理Liferay继承的角色?

Orbeon如何处理Liferay继承的角色?,liferay,orbeon,Liferay,Orbeon,使用Liferay用户/角色映射在Liferay 6.1.1-CE上运行4.1.0.2013040182144-PE Liferay场景: User: Joe User Group: admin Role: form-admin Joe是admin的成员,admin是form admin的成员,我可以在FB中为form admin成功设置基于表单的权限。但是,对于只读约束,我不能在表单中使用表单管理,我需要用户直接成为角色的成员 这是Liferay角色传递的已知约束吗?我不确定:我们使用Lif

使用Liferay用户/角色映射在Liferay 6.1.1-CE上运行4.1.0.2013040182144-PE

Liferay场景:

User: Joe
User Group: admin
Role: form-admin
Joe是admin的成员,admin是form admin的成员,我可以在FB中为form admin成功设置基于表单的权限。但是,对于只读约束,我不能在表单中使用表单管理,我需要用户直接成为角色的成员


这是Liferay角色传递的已知约束吗?

我不确定:我们使用Liferay的
PortalUtil.getUser()
来获取用户信息,使用
getRoles()
来获取角色,请参见此。从那里我们只使用角色列表。谢谢Erik-在基于表单的访问决策和填充传递变量($fr角色)中都使用了相同的列表?不,我不知道这有什么问题。我使用频繁用户组来定义公共权限:user-X Hi-Mark-您是将它们用于基于表单的权限还是按字段约束(只读等)?是的,这就是$fr角色的来源。